Keyword research
Using local SEO keywords can help you get noticed on search engine results pages (SERPs) that are relevant to your location. This could result in more unpaid website traffic as well as foot traffic and inquiries. It is important to keep in mind that not all keywords have the same value. This is particularly applicable to local searches. This is because local searches tend to be conducted with intent, which means that the user is seeking to take action in the immediate future.
When conducting local keyword research, it is important to take into consideration your competitors' websites and their rank in SERPs. This will help you decide which keywords to target, and which areas your efforts should be directed. Google Keyword Planner is a useful tool that helps you find and analyze relevant keywords for your business model.
It is also important to keep in mind that a successful keyword strategy is dependent on the overall health of your site. If your site has poor on-page optimization, it'll be difficult to rank for any keyword. It is important to ensure that your site has a good on-page SEO and a content marketing plan.
Many online tools allow you to conduct keyword research for free. A keyword tool will save you time and money as it will provide you with a list of keywords that are relevant to your website. A keyword tool can also help you analyze search volume, competition levels and organic SERP results. You can also receive recommendations for long tail keywords that are unique to the market. These long-tail keywords are less competitive but can be more effective in your business.

Off-page optimization
Off-page optimization plays a vital role in the operations of local search companies. It involves promoting your site and its content to social media, influencers and local listings. If done correctly this can boost your rankings in organic searches for keywords that have an intent to be local. It also helps you get a position in the Google Local Pack, which displays three local businesses related to a search query. You must implement off-site SEO practices consistently to make the most out of this strategy.
Off-site SEO is all about establishing a strong brand reputation. It's how search engines measure your credibility and trustworthiness. It's a way to measure things like citations, links and testimonials from other websites. It is also important to ensure that your NAP (names, addresses telephone numbers) are consistent across all platforms online including business directories and social media. It is important to keep your NAP consistent because it helps search engines to link the dots between all of these pieces of information.
Participating in forums for your industry is another off-page SEO technique. You can build a positive image by offering advice and expertise to others within your industry. You can also use forums to talk with customers, and this can provide valuable information about customer behavior.
Another off-page SEO strategy is to contact other websites in your field and request that they link to your site. This can be a lengthy procedure, but it will pay off in the long run. It's a great method to build brand awareness and generate traffic to your site. Using this approach can help you avoid negative SEO attacks which are a frequent problem for many websites.

Link building
Local search is a vital aspect of online marketing for businesses with a particular geographical location. It involves optimizing the web page of a company and listing the information on directories like Google My Business, Yelp and Bing. These listings are then incorporated into Google's local results. To maximize their impact, they must be consistent across all platforms and updated regularly.
Local SEO is a complex process with many moving parts. However, the process of building links is the most important aspect. Google uses backlinks to judge the quality and authority of a site. The more high-quality links your site has, the more prominent it will appear in the SERPs. However, there are numerous ways to build links that could hurt your ranking, and it's essential to stay clear of these strategies for a chance to remain competitive over the long term.
One of the best ways to build links is to create high-quality content that people will be able to share, comment on, and even link to. You could also offer to write a guest post on other blogs and websites that are relevant to your niche. best seo company can also use social media platforms to promote your content and grow an audience.
It is also important to avoid manipulative practices, such as buying links. These could result in the issuance of a Google penalty. These practices are referred to as black-hat search engine optimization, and could adversely affect your search engine ranking.
